Image: A Quarterly of the Visual Arts, No.3 1949 Branding "As a precaution against designEditor: Robert Harling Publisher: Art and Technics Ltd, London Publication: 1949, First Edition Binding: Softcover, section sewn Pages: 84 Size: 185 x 248 Text: English Beautifully produced British art journal published between 1949 and 1952. It emerged from the earlier Alphabet and Image (19461948), which divided into two separate periodicals: Alphabet, devoted to typography, and Image, focused exclusively on the visual arts.
